From e6db3c08963c9df478b7a2958adb078153dba5b5 Mon Sep 17 00:00:00 2001 From: Yifei Teng Date: Wed, 2 May 2018 11:31:49 -0500 Subject: [PATCH] unsafeSignature -> makeUnsafeSignature() --- SwiftGit2/Objects.swift | 2 +- SwiftGit2/Repository.swift |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/SwiftGit2/Objects.swift b/SwiftGit2/Objects.swift index 8bde25f..3c815c0 100644 --- a/SwiftGit2/Objects.swift +++ b/SwiftGit2/Objects.swift @@ -56,7 +56,7 @@ public struct Signature { /// Return an unsafe pointer to the `git_signature` struct. /// Caller is responsible for freeing it with `git_signature_free`. - var unsafeSignature: Result, NSError> { + func makeUnsafeSignature() -> Result, NSError> { var signature: UnsafeMutablePointer? = nil let time = git_time_t(self.time.timeIntervalSince1970) // Unix epoch time let offset: Int32 = Int32(timeZone.secondsFromGMT(for: self.time) / 60) diff --git a/SwiftGit2/Repository.swift b/SwiftGit2/Repository.swift index d36eb8e..78e34ec 100644 --- a/SwiftGit2/Repository.swift +++ b/SwiftGit2/Repository.swift @@ -622,7 +622,7 @@ final public class Repository { signature: Signature ) -> Result { // create commit signature - return signature.unsafeSignature.flatMap { signature in + return signature.makeUnsafeSignature().flatMap { signature in defer { git_signature_free(signature) } var tree: OpaquePointer? = nil var treeOIDCopy = treeOID